Bench top power supplies are used by product development laboratories, bench technicians, training colleges, repair technicians and for general circuit testing. A bench top power supply must be able to supply the precise voltage or range of voltages and currents needed by the product or products being tested. Consequently, some are geared to provide an exact and consistent fixed output while others are designed to offer a wider range of electrical output characteristics.
